Ubuntu quá nóng - Thông báo cho tôi trước khi tắt máy?


3

Tôi gặp sự cố trên Ubuntu (11.10 vẫn còn) khiến máy của tôi bị tắt máy nghiêm trọng. Tôi đã xác định sự cố là sự cố quá nhiệt, thấy dòng sau trong / var / log / syslog:

kernel: [ 1815.505465] Critical temperature reached (128 C), shutting down.

Bây giờ tôi muốn biết những gì gây ra vấn đề quá nóng này. Nó đã xảy ra nhiều lần rồi, nhưng hoàn cảnh vẫn chưa thể nhận dạng được tôi. Thỉnh thoảng tôi đang xem một bộ phim, đôi khi chỉ cần duyệt web ... Nó có thể có liên quan đến một lỗi được ném bởi Opera, nhưng tôi không chắc chắn. Nhưng đây là dòng syslog cuối cùng trước khi lặn mũi:

operapluginwrap[2613]: segfault at 506 ip 00007fab1814bf40 sp 00007fff6ff89258 error 4 in libgobject-2.0.so.0.3000.0[7fab18119000+4e000

Dù sao, của tôi câu hỏi :
Có cách nào để làm cho hệ thống cảnh báo tôi trong trường hợp quá nóng, có thể khoảng 5-10 độ dưới giới hạn quá nhiệt thực tế?

Điều này có thể sẽ cho tôi cơ hội xác định quá trình gây ra tải / nhiệt khổng lồ ... Xin lỗi, tôi không muốn ngăn máy ngừng hoạt động nếu phải - Tôi thà chịu một số sự cố hơn là có CPU của mình đi lên trong khoi...

Ghi chú: Tôi đang cố gắng xác định một quá trình / chủ đề giả mạo. Tôi chưa (chưa) quan tâm đến việc ngăn chặn quá nhiệt.


3
CPU của bạn quá nóng, vì vậy hãy thực hiện các bước bình thường mà bạn sẽ xử lý với CPU quá nóng. Bắt đầu bằng cách làm sạch máy tính, sau đó nếu là máy tính để bàn, hãy dán miếng dán nhiệt mới.
Ramhound

Việc cài đặt càng sạch càng tốt mà không cần cài đặt lại đầy đủ. Máy là Lenovo ThinkPad T400 - nó phục vụ tốt cho tôi trong nhiều năm với tải trọng cao. Đề nghị dán nhiệt thực sự không hữu ích. Ngoài ra, không có lý do nào trên trái đất tại sao trình duyệt, ứng dụng video hoặc ứng dụng văn phòng lại làm quá nóng máy lõi kép 2 GHz.
fgysin

Nếu CPU máy tính xách tay thực sự đạt tới 128C, có một vấn đề rõ ràng ở đâu đó và một cảnh báo sẽ chỉ là một cách giải quyết. Kiểm tra cài đặt nguồn điện của bạn, để đảm bảo bạn không ở một số cài đặt "luôn luôn 100%". Cũng đảm bảo rằng quạt của bạn đang hoạt động và không có bụi. Và tại sao bỏ qua các bình luận dán nhiệt? Đây chỉ là các bước bảo trì tiêu chuẩn.
trpt4him

Vấn đề là, tôi có thể chạy CPU của mình ở mức dường như 100% trong vài phút mà không bị quá nóng (nó ổn định ở mức cao, nhưng bền vững 97-100C); ở chế độ không tải, nhiệt độ khoảng 40C mà không tải CPU. Lý do để tôi loại bỏ giải pháp dán nhiệt đơn giản là nó không liên quan gì đến câu hỏi của tôi. Tôi yêu cầu khả năng cảnh báo / tin nhắn trong trường hợp nhiệt độ cao. Tôi KHÔNG hỏi làm thế nào để ngăn CPU của tôi quá nóng.
fgysin

Ngoài đỉnh đầu của tôi, bạn có thể sử dụng lm_sensors, thăm dò giá trị phù hợp, sau đó so sánh nó với giá trị bạn cảm thấy thoải mái. Nếu không ai khác có thể trả lời, tôi sẽ thử hack vào cuối tuần.
Journeyman Geek

Câu trả lời:


2

Hãy thử cài đặt chỉ báo tần số cpu:

sudo apt-get install indicator-cpufreq

Điều này sẽ cài đặt một biểu tượng trong appmenu, tại đây bạn có thể nhấp và chuyển CPU của mình sang các cài đặt bảo thủ hơn; xem nếu điều này giúp.

Hoặc bạn có thể dùng thử Psensor từ Trung tâm phần mềm Ubuntu.

Nếu không có cải thiện, có thể kiểm tra tài nguyên này:

https://wiki.ubfox.com/Kernel/PowerQuản lý

Ví dụ: "Chỉ báo thời tiết" có vấn đề vì nó liên tục ghi vào tệp nhật ký, ngăn không cho ổ đĩa không hoạt động ở chế độ tiết kiệm năng lượng, gây nóng, kích hoạt quạt, v.v. Điều này được đề cập trong nghiên cứu. Cố gắng tìm các ứng dụng làm điều này và gỡ cài đặt chúng.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.